脂肪型和瘦肉型猪H-FABP基因分子标记研究

【摘要】 本试验利用PCR-RFLP(HinfⅠ、HaeⅢ和MspⅠ3种限制性内切酶)分子标记技术,检测了杜洛克、长白、大白、内江猪、荣昌猪、汉江黑猪、汉白猪、八眉猪和野猪共计265头猪心脏脂肪酸结合蛋白基因5’-上游区和第二内含子区的遗传变异。结果表明,在HinfⅠ-RFLP位点上,上述猪种和野猪均存在多态性,等位基因H的频率分别为0.7500,0.7188,0.9167,0.3333,0.1250,0.6909,0.1167,0.8500和0.9375;除汉江黑猪(P<0.05)和野猪(P<0.01)外,其余的猪种基因频率和基因型频率都处于Hardy-Weinberg平衡状态(P>0.05);大白、八眉、汉江黑猪、汉白猪和野猪表现为低度多态(PIC<0.25),杜洛克、长白猪、内江猪和荣昌猪为中度多态性(0.25<PIC<0.5);而在HaeⅢ-RFLP和MspⅠ-RFLP位点上,仅内江猪、荣昌猪、汉江黑猪和八眉猪为单态。

【Abstract】 In this experiment, genetic variations of 5’-upstream region and the second intron of H-FABP gene in 265 pig from Duroc, Landrance, Largewhite, Neijiang pig, Rongchang pig, Hanjiang black pig, Hanzhong white pig, Bamei pig and wild pig were detected by PCR-RFLP molecular marker with HinfⅠ, HaeⅢ and MspⅠ. The results showed that polymorphisms for HinfⅠ-RFLP in above pig breeds were detected and frequencies of allele H were 0.7500, 0.7188, 0.9167, 0.3333, 0.1250, 0.6909, 0.1167, 0.8500 and 0.9375 respectively; except in Hanjiang black pig (P<0.05) and wild pig(P<0.01), frequencies of gene and genotype in other breeds were in equilibrium of Hardy-Weinberg (P>0.05); Large white, Bamei pig, Hanjiang black pig, Hanzhong white pig and wild pig presented low polymorphisms (P/C<0.25), while other breeds have mediated polymorphisms (0.25<PIC<0.5) . Polymorphisms of H-FABP gene for the HaeⅢ-RFLP and MspI-RFLP were not detected in only 4 Chinese local pig breeds (Neijiang pig, Rongchang pig, Hanjiang black pig and Bamei pig Bamei pig) among tested breeds.
